Verification Process for Special Settings (VPSS)

What is VPSS?
VPSS is a state-approved advanced certification process by which secondary teachers in "special settings" have an additional option to become compliant with No Child Left Behind legislation.  Completion of VPSS will allow eligible teachers to become "Highly Qualified" without taking high-stress tests or spending long hours on college coursework.  It incorporates specific subject matter knowledge with practical application targeted to hard-to-staff settings.

Who is eligible for VPSS?
VPSS is designed for teachers who teach two or more core academic subjects in the following settings:

  • Secondary special education settings

  • Secondary Alternative programs

  • Secondary Small Rural School Achievement (SRSA) Programs

  • Independent study
